Forged parts meaning rotating assembly: Pistons, rods, crankshaft. Forged is always a lot more forgiving when it comes to abuse than the OEM parts. That being said anything will break with enough abuse. I've seen a completely forged assembly with ARP fastners rip the top off a piston with 22 lbs of boost and too much timing.
If you search around tho it's been stated on here of guys running 150 shot on stock 350 without issues.
